“…To further improve mechanical properties, nontoxicity, noncarcinogenic effect, and bioadhesive properties, polyethylene glycol (PEG) can be used to blend with PVA, which forms strong interactions due to hydrogen bond formation [36][37][38]. Hence, many researchers combined at least two of these mentioned polymers-PVA, PVP, PEG, and CS-to create new antimicrobial agents with various applications [39][40][41][42][43][44][45][46][47][48][49]. Additionally, these polymers are capable of degrading naturally, compatible with biological systems, have the ability to form films, and have been previously documented for their use in topical applications [9,50,51].…”
